导言:本文针对TPWallet最新版所集成的柚子币(YuzuCoin)智能合约,结合高效支付应用、高性能数字科技、市场未来评估、交易失败原因分析、网络可扩展性与权限管理六大视角进行系统剖析,并提出可行性改进建议与风险缓释措施。
一、高效支付应用场景与设计要点
- 即时结算与低延迟路径:合约应优化 gas 消耗和调用路径,减少跨合约调用、避免冗余存储写入;建议引入离链签名(支付通道/状态通道)用于小额高频支付,降低链上确认成本。
- 用户体验与失败回退:钱包需在交易发起端进行预估 gas、费用控件和失败回滚提示;对失败交易提供自动重放策略与友好错误码映射,避免用户重复支付。
二、高效能数字科技实现策略
- 合约级别:使用紧凑数据结构(例如 packed storage)、事件代替冗余状态存储;对密集逻辑采用库合约复用并开启优化编译。
- 基础设施层:建议TPWallet支持基于WASM或eWASM的执行环境以及并行交易池以提升吞吐;集成轻量级节点与速链API以改善查询和广播性能。
三、市场未来评估报告要点
- 竞争态势:柚子币若定位为支付媒介,应与稳定币、央行数字货币以及Layer2结算系竞争,需突出低手续费与快速确认率。
- 采用曲线:短期内用户增长依赖于商户接入与第三方SDK,长期则看网络可扩展性和流动性深度。建议制定激励计划(流动性挖矿、商户补贴)并与合规策略并行。
四、交易失败的常见原因与应对
- 常见原因:nonce 错误、gas 不足、跨合约重入保护触发、链上滑点/价格预言机故障、链分叉或拥堵。

- 应对策略:在钱包端加入本地模拟和预估、增加交易替换(replace-by-fee)机制、重放保护与原子化批处理;关键通道引入回退合约(fallback)以保证用户资金安全。
五、可扩展性网络设计建议
- Layer2 与 Rollup:优先支持 optimistic/polygon 类 Rollup 或 zk-rollup 作为支付结算层,兼顾吞吐与安全性。
- 分段分片与跨链桥:采用状态分片或分层账本,再配合轻量跨链桥实现跨网络清算;但需严格检验桥的经济安全与验证者模型。
- 性能指标:目标确认时间<2s(体验)、TPS 可扩展到千级;并建立 SLA 监控体系。
六、权限管理与安全治理
- 最小权限原则:合约采用角色化访问控制(RBAC),敏感操作需多签或时间锁(timelock)保护。
- 可升级性与治理:采用代理合约模式(transparent 或 UUPS),升级触发需多重治理投票或 DAO 授权,保留可验证审计日志。
- 审计与监控:定期第三方安全审计、模糊测试(fuzzing)、形式化验证关键模块;运行时配置警报、链上异常检测与自动熔断机制。
结论与行动清单:

- 短期(0–3月):优化合约 gas、改进钱包端预估与失败回退、引入多签关键操作。
- 中期(3–12月):部署 Layer2 支持、完善可升级治理与审计流程、开展商户接入计划。
- 长期(12月+):拓展跨链清算、推进 zk 技术与并行执行以实现千TPS级别与企业级支付服务。
整体评价:TPWallet 的柚子币合约已具备作为支付媒介的基础能力,但要成为高效、可扩展且商业化的支付解决方案,需要在链下扩展、权限治理与市场激励上同步推进。谨慎的安全测试与透明治理将是能否取得用户与商户信任的关键。
评论
Alex89
文章很全面,尤其是对失败交易的回退策略讲得很实用。
小李
建议尽快实现Layer2支持,支付体验是关键。
CryptoFan
权限管理那部分必须重视,多签与timelock是必须的。
雨夜
期待更多关于zk-rollup落地实现的细节分析。
Luna
市场激励和商户补贴策略写得好,很有参考价值。